Stokesian Dynamic Simulation of Sedimenting Spheres in a Newtonian Fluid Stokesian Dynamics, a method developed by Brady and Bossis in the 80s, simulates the 3D motion of hydrodynamically interacting spheres at low Reynolds numbers. This program was originally written by Professor Ron Phillips during his PhD thesis at MIT in 1989. The code was adapted from Fortran 77... Platforms: Matlab

Gromacs for Mac OS X and Linux GROMACS is a versatile package to perform molecular dynamics, i.e. simulate the Newtonian equations of motion for systems with hundreds to millions of particles. It is primarily designed for biochemical molecules like proteins, lipids and nucleic acids that have a lot of complicated bonded... Platforms: Mac, Linux
